Here is how to spot and stop WooCommerce affiliate coupon abuse before it drains your commission budget.<\/strong><\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Affiliate coupon abuse happens when affiliates use coupon codes to claim commissions on sales they never actually sent you. To prevent it in WooCommerce, block self-referrals, lock each coupon to an approved referrer domain, set limits on who can use each code, and review your affiliate reports for suspicious order patterns. Most of this can be automated with the right plugin settings, and this guide walks through each step.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Quick disclosure before we start: the two plugins featured in this post, <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Coupons affili\u00e9s<\/a> et <a href=\"https:\/\/relywp.com\/plugins\/better-coupon-restrictions-woocommerce\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Meilleures restrictions pour les coupons<\/a>, are both built by us at RelyWP. The prevention tips below work with any affiliate setup, but the screenshots and settings shown come from our own plugins.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Jump to a section: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><a href=\"#what-is-affiliate-coupon-abuse\">What is affiliate coupon abuse in WooCommerce?<\/a><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><a href=\"#types-of-affiliate-coupon-abuse\">4 types of affiliate coupon abuse<\/a><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><a href=\"#how-to-prevent-affiliate-coupon-abuse\">7 ways to prevent affiliate coupon abuse<\/a><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><a href=\"#prevent-regular-coupon-abuse\">Preventing regular coupon abuse in WooCommerce<\/a><\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><a href=\"#faq\">Frequently asked questions<\/a><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"what-is-affiliate-coupon-abuse\" class=\"wp-block-heading\">Qu'est-ce que l'abus de coupon d'affiliation dans WooCommerce ?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In WooCommerce, affiliate coupon abuse is a form of fraud where affiliates exploit coupon codes to earn commissions on sales they had no real part in. Sometimes that means manipulating your coupon system directly. Other times it means hijacking credit for purchases that would have happened anyway.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The cost shows up in a few places: inflated <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/payer-les-affilies-dans-woocommerce\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">paiements des affili\u00e9s<\/a>une vision d\u00e9form\u00e9e de votre <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/woocommerce-affiliate-marketing-kpis-metrics\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">le retour sur investissement du programme d'affiliation<\/a>, and in worse cases chargebacks, lost customers, and damage to your brand&#8217;s reputation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"types-of-affiliate-coupon-abuse\" class=\"wp-block-heading\">Types d'abus de coupons d'affiliation WooCommerce<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/comment-prevenir-la-fraude-a-laffiliation\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Affiliate coupon fraud<\/a> comes in different shapes and sizes. Here are the four most common tactics, what they look like in practice, and the main defense against each.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table class=\"has-fixed-layout\"><thead><tr><th>Abuse type<\/th><th>What it looks like<\/th><th>Main defense<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td>Auto-saisine<\/td><td>Affiliates order with their own code and pocket the commission<\/td><td>Enable automatic self-referral blocking<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Farce de biscuits<\/td><td>Tracking cookies planted in browsers without a real click<\/td><td>Audit traffic sources and shorten cookie windows<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Achats frauduleux<\/td><td>Orders paid with stolen or disposable cards, followed by chargebacks<\/td><td>Vet applicants and hold payouts past the refund window<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Fausses annonces<\/td><td>Made-up &#8220;exclusive&#8221; discounts published to intercept buyers<\/td><td>Lock coupons to approved referrer domains<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Auto-saisine<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Probably the most blatant form of affiliate coupon fraud. Self-referrals happen when affiliates use their own referral link or coupon code to buy from your store, taking the discount and pocketing the commission on top.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">They do this by creating fake customer accounts on your site, or by ordering under the details of friends and family and splitting the reward.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Farce de biscuits<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">With cookie stuffing, the affiliate runs a script that silently drops their <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/creation-dun-programme-daffiliation-sans-cuisson\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">cookies de suivi<\/a> into the browsers of people who visit their website, even if the visitor never clicks an actual affiliate link.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Cookies are usually valid for weeks or months. So when that person later visits your store on their own and makes a purchase, the affiliate collects the credit and the commission that comes with it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Achats frauduleux<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Fraudulent affiliates can apply their own coupon codes and pay using disposable virtual cards, compromised credit cards, or stolen card details to trigger commission payouts.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The orders look legitimate at first. Then, within days, the chargebacks and delivery failures start rolling in. If your payout schedule allows it, the affiliate may have already cashed out before the refund window hits.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">You end up losing the product, paying the refund, covering the commission already paid out, and eating any chargeback fees from your payment processor.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Fausses annonces<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Affiliates can create fake &#8220;deal pages&#8221; to attract coupon-hunting customers even when no real discount or promotion is running.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">They publish search-optimized blog posts and <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/comment-creer-automatiquement-des-pages-datterrissage-pour-les-affilies\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">pages d'atterrissage<\/a> claiming to offer codes for <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/campagne-de-marketing-daffiliation-pour-le-vendredi-noir\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">de fortes r\u00e9ductions<\/a> (think &#8220;30% Off YourBrand Today Only&#8221; or &#8220;Exclusive Promo Code&#8221;) when no <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/offres-du-vendredi-noir-woocommerce\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">de tels accords<\/a> exist, then embed expired or fabricated codes alongside their affiliate links.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Some of these listings rank in Google or get reposted to deal sites. Shoppers click through hoping for the advertised discount, and the affiliate earns credit for intercepting customers who already intended to buy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"how-to-prevent-affiliate-coupon-abuse\" class=\"wp-block-heading\">How to Prevent WooCommerce Affiliate Coupon Abuse<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Below, we&#8217;ll show you how to use the inbuilt <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/documents\/prevention-de-la-fraude-par-les-affilies\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">param\u00e8tres anti-fraude<\/a> en <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Coupons affili\u00e9s<\/a>, our own affiliate marketing plugin, to stop affiliates from misusing coupons in your WooCommerce store.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Not yet using Coupon Affiliates? Block self-referrals automatically<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/documents\/prevention-de-la-fraude-par-les-affilies\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Coupons affili\u00e9s<\/a> can prevent affiliates from using their own coupon codes on their orders.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Once this setting is enabled, the plugin checks the customer details at checkout and blocks the code from being applied if it belongs to the person placing the order.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full border-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-1.png\" alt=\"Self-referral blocking option in the Coupon Affiliates fraud prevention settings\" class=\"wp-image-20303\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">2. Vet affiliate program applicants<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Screen each applicant carefully before accepting them into your affiliate program.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Adaptez votre <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/formulaire-daffiliation-et-page-dinscription\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">formulaire d'inscription pour les affili\u00e9s<\/a> to collect details about each applicant&#8217;s business type, promotional strategy, and the platforms they use. Then manually review their site, content quality, and audience relevance before approving them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large border-image\"><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"791\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form-1024x791.png\" alt=\"Custom affiliate registration form built with Coupon Affiliates in WooCommerce\" class=\"wp-image-15019\" srcset=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form-1024x791.png 1024w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form-300x232.png 300w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form-768x594.png 768w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form-360x278.png 360w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/WooCommerce-affiliate-registration-form.png 1334w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Red flags include no real web presence, disposable email addresses, or duplicate details across multiple applicants.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Use Coupon Affiliates to add the relevant fields to your affiliate registration form, and only assign unique coupons to users you have approved.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">3. Define coupon usage terms in your affiliate agreement<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Require affiliates to accept an agreement covering your <a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/comment-creer-des-conditions-daffiliation\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">conditions du programme d'affiliation<\/a> during registration, so nobody can claim ignorance if they break the rules.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">At a minimum, the agreement should set out your rules on self-referrals, code sharing, paid search ads, payout timelines, unauthorized promotion channels, and prohibited traffic types. Holding payouts until the refund window has passed is also worth writing into your terms, since it protects you from the chargeback scenario covered earlier.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The contract should also spell out the consequences of a violation, whether that&#8217;s commission forfeiture, an account ban, or legal follow-up.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">4. Lock coupons to approved referrer domains<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Tying each coupon to an approved referrer domain puts a stop to coupon theft and public misuse, because the code only works when the customer arrives through the affiliate&#8217;s own site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Pour ce faire, cr\u00e9ez un coupon unique par affili\u00e9, puis activez la fonction \"<a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/documents\/pro-direct-link-tracking\/\">Suivi des liens directs<\/a>&#8221; feature along with the option: <strong>N'autoriser l'application de coupons d'affiliation que lorsqu'ils sont directement li\u00e9s \u00e0 un domaine approuv\u00e9.<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large border-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"581\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-1024x581.png\" alt=\"Direct Link Tracking setting in Coupon Affiliates restricting coupons to approved referrer domains\" class=\"wp-image-20337\" srcset=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-1024x581.png 1024w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-300x170.png 300w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-768x435.png 768w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-360x204.png 360w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873-133x75.png 133w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/03d6fcb87649c7f92a841b27f5dda873.png 1397w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This protects you when a coupon ends up on a public site or a browser extension like Honey, but the affiliate had nothing to do with the sale.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">5. Set coupon usage limits and conditions<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Enforce limits around who can use affiliate coupon codes, how often, and under what conditions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Without proper restrictions, two or more affiliates can stack codes on one order to split the credit or trigger double payouts. Existing customers can also keep reusing affiliate coupons to grab discounts on repeat purchases.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Coupon Affiliates handles both situations: you can restrict checkout to one coupon per order, and restrict coupon usage to first-time customers only.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full border-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-2.png\" alt=\"Affiliate agreement acceptance option in the Coupon Affiliates registration settings\" class=\"wp-image-20304\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">6. Audit affiliate reports regularly<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Even if fraudsters slip under your radar, regularly reviewing your affiliate program&#8217;s performance reports can catch them after the fact.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><a href=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/fr\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Coupons affili\u00e9s<\/a> collects in-depth data on your program&#8217;s performance, including per-affiliate order data, customer info, IP addresses, and order patterns.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full border-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"841\" height=\"542\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/015df051eddaf2fc83618a1fe47b2b6c.png\" alt=\"Affiliate order report in Coupon Affiliates showing customer details and order data\" class=\"wp-image-5268\" srcset=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/015df051eddaf2fc83618a1fe47b2b6c.png 841w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/015df051eddaf2fc83618a1fe47b2b6c-300x193.png 300w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/015df051eddaf2fc83618a1fe47b2b6c-768x495.png 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 841px) 100vw, 841px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Here&#8217;s what to watch for while auditing affiliate performance reports: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Pics soudains d'utilisation d'un coupon.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Ordres regroup\u00e9s sur des p\u00e9riodes courtes et pr\u00e9sentant des valeurs ou des sch\u00e9mas identiques.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Un volume important de nouveaux utilisateurs sans source de trafic de r\u00e9f\u00e9rence.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Duplicate names, duplicate emails, or IP clusters.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">7. Blacklist repeat offenders<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Some fraudsters just don&#8217;t quit. They switch emails, rotate IPs through proxies or VPNs, and keep finding new ways to game your coupon system. At that point you need to block them at the store level.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Use the Coupon Affiliates &#8220;Visitors Blacklist&#8221; setting to flag specific IP addresses so they can&#8217;t sign up for your affiliate program or use affiliate coupons.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The &#8220;Domains Blacklist&#8221; setting goes a step further by blocking customers referred from blacklisted domains from applying coupon codes at all.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large border-image\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"712\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3-1024x712.png\" alt=\"Visitors Blacklist and Domains Blacklist settings in Coupon Affiliates\" class=\"wp-image-20305\" srcset=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3-1024x712.png 1024w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3-300x209.png 300w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3-768x534.png 768w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3-360x250.png 360w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/WooCommerce-affiliate-coupon-abuse-3.png 1116w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"prevent-regular-coupon-abuse\" class=\"wp-block-heading\">Bonus: Prevent Regular Coupon Abuse in WooCommerce<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">You now know how to stop affiliates from misusing coupon codes. For example: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Exiger que les clients soient connect\u00e9s avant d'appliquer un coupon.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Only allow specific user roles, like wholesale customers or VIP members, to use a coupon.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Set usage limits based on the number of orders a customer has placed or their total spend.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Limiter l'utilisation des coupons aux clients ayant une adresse sp\u00e9cifique.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Cap how many times customers at a specific billing or shipping address can use a coupon.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Limiter l'utilisation des coupons aux clients r\u00e9f\u00e9renc\u00e9s par des domaines sp\u00e9cifiques.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Bloquer l'utilisation de coupons par des clients ayant une adresse IP sp\u00e9cifique.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Limit coupon usage based on customer metadata or cookies stored in their browser.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large border-image\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"768\" src=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382-1024x768.png\" alt=\"Advanced coupon restriction rules in the Better Coupon Restrictions plugin settings\" class=\"wp-image-20329\" srcset=\"https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382-1024x768.png 1024w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382-300x225.png 300w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382-768x576.png 768w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382-360x270.png 360w, https:\/\/couponaffiliates.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/04\/6c41f6c479ed5e3298b7699e57e41d1b-1548x832x220x0x1110x832x1739374382.png 1110w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Check out Better Coupon Restrictions in its <a href=\"https:\/\/wordpress.org\/plugins\/better-coupon-restrictions\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">gratuit<\/a> ou <a href=\"https:\/\/relywp.com\/plugins\/better-coupon-restrictions-woocommerce\/\" data-type=\"link\" data-id=\"https:\/\/relywp.com\/plugins\/better-coupon-restrictions-woocommerce\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">pro<\/a> version today.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"faq\" class=\"wp-block-heading\">Frequently Asked Questions<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Can affiliates use their own coupon codes in WooCommerce?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Only if you let them. WooCommerce itself won&#8217;t stop an affiliate from applying their own code at checkout. Coupon Affiliates includes a self-referral blocking setting that compares the customer&#8217;s details against the coupon owner and rejects the code if they match.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">How do my coupon codes end up on sites like Honey or RetailMeNot?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Usually a customer or affiliate shares a working code, and coupon aggregators pick it up from there. Once a code is public, anyone can apply it, and the affiliate it belongs to earns commission on sales they never referred. Locking coupons to approved referrer domains stops leaked codes from working outside the affiliate&#8217;s own site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Does WooCommerce have built-in coupon fraud protection?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Not much. WooCommerce offers basic usage restrictions like per-coupon and per-user limits, minimum spend, and product exclusions. It has no IP restrictions, no purchase-history conditions, and no referrer checks, which is why most stores running an affiliate program add a plugin to fill those gaps.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Should I ban an affiliate the first time they break the rules?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">It depends on the violation. An honest mistake, like sharing a code in a channel your terms don&#8217;t allow, usually deserves a warning and a chance to correct it. Deliberate fraud such as self-referrals, stolen card purchases, or fake deal pages is a different story. Withhold the commissions, remove the affiliate, and blacklist their details so they can&#8217;t rejoin under a new account.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Mettre un terme \u00e0 l'abus de coupons d'affiliation<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Left unchecked, affiliate coupon fraud eats into your profit margins and can damage your brand&#8217;s reputation.
